Mastering the Art of CV Writing: A Step-by-Step Guide for Career Changers

Creating your CV can seem like a daunting task, but it is essential to securing your dream job. Your CV is your document that highlights your qualifications, skills, and experience in a clear and concise manner. Its goal is to demonstrate potential employers why you are the perfect candidate for the job.

When writing your CV, it is important to remember that employers are looking for certain key information. They want to learn about your qualifications, work experience, and relevant skills. They also hope to see that you have achieved certain achievements in your previous roles.

Want to make your CV stand out? Here are some expert tips to help you impress employers:

  • Customise your CV to the specific job you are applying for by highlighting the skills and experience that match with the requirements listed in the job description.
  • Use impactful action words and phrases to detail your achievements and responsibilities in your previous roles.
  • Keep the structure and styling of your CV clear and professional. Avoid using overly-designed designs or fonts.
  • Provide detailed examples of your qualifications and experience, rather than making non-specific statements.
  • Proofread and review your CV multiple times to ensure there are no errors or typos.

There are several common formats that CVs can take, such as chronological, functional, or combination. Each format has its own benefits and weaknesses, so it’s important to choose one that best emphasises your qualifications and experience.

You can find examples of these formats online and choose the one that suits for you.

Writing About Yourself on your Resume

When it comes to writing about your personal profile, it’s important to maintain the proper balance between the emphasis on your abilities and being humble. One way to do this is by creating an effective personal statement or summary that highlights your strengths and qualifications in a succinct, compelling manner.

One tip for writing an effective personal statement is to emphasise the specific skills and experiences that make you a suitable match for the job it is you’re applying. This could include things such as your educationlevel, your work experience and any volunteering or extracurricular activities.

Another important aspect of writing about yourself on your resume is to highlight your distinctive selling points, or what sets you apart from other applicants. This can include things like specific accomplishments or awards or any relevant certifications or courses you’ve taken.

It’s recommended to use specific, measurable language when describing your skills and achievements. For example, instead of simply saying that you’re "good in working with groups," you could say that you "led an entire team of 5 people to get a fifteen% increase efficiency."

When it comes to formatting your resume, you must use an elegant, clear layout and to avoid using overly graphic or fancy fonts. Choose a font that is standard and bullet points to make your resume easy to scan.

When you include personal information It is essential to ensure they are relevant to your job including hobbies or interests that prove certain abilities, instead of providing irrelevant information.

In the end, describing yourself on your resume may be difficult If you focus on your strengths, your qualifications and distinctive selling points, and using specific, measurable words, you can craft your own personal narrative that sets yourself apart from other applicants and creates a positive impression upon potential employers.

How to Write a Cover Letter for an application to a job

In today’s highly competitive job market, a well-written cover letter could make a significant difference in how well your application gets noticed. A cover letter is an item which is attached to your resume and will usually be included with your job application. It’s an opportunity for you to introduce yourself to the manager who will be hiring you and present the reasons why you’re the best candidate for the job.

When writing a cover letters it is crucial to keep in mind that your cover letter must be tailored to the specific job and company which you’re applying. It is important to research the company and the job advertisement before you start writing. Also, you should be sure to write in a professional manner and refrain from using informal phrases.

The most crucial elements of a cover letter is the opening line. It’s your chance to grab the hiring manager’s attention and create a memorable first impression. You should start with an engaging opening that emphasises your strengths and makes clear why you’re submitting for the job.

A crucial aspect of the cover letter is to explain how your experience and skills meet the needs of the position. Use specific examples to demonstrate that your work experience and skills are a perfect fit for the position.

It’s also important to finish your cover letter with a strong closing. This is your opportunity to thank the hiring manager for taking the time to review your application as well as to confirm your enthusiasm for the job.
